Question :When was the Rowlatt Act was passed?

(a) 10 March, 1919
(b) 8 March, 1919
(c) 12 March, 1919
(d) 3 March, 1919

Show Answer :

Answer : (a) 10 March, 1919
Despite the large number of protests, the Rowlatt Act came into effect on 10 March 1919. The Rowlatt Act allowed the British government to imprison people without due trial.

Question :What was the Sedition Act 1870?

(a) Rowlatt act
(b) Arbitrary act
(c) Protection against British
(d) None of these

Show Answer :

Answer : (b) Arbitrary act
The Sedition Act 1870 was the arbitrary act passed by the British government. According to it government could arrest any person protesting or criticizing it. Indian nationalists protested and criticized against this arbitrary act of the Bruisers.

Question :What was the Rowlatt Act?

(a) To control migrants
(b) To control revolutionary activities
(c) To control wealth of Indian
(d) None of these

Show Answer :

Answer : (b) To control revolutionary activities
Rowlatt Act was passed by the British Government to control revolutionary activities. Under this new rule the government had the authority and the power to arrest people and keep them imprisoned without trial if they are suspected with the charge of terrorism.
